Roofers win contract increases totaling $10.28

Members of Roofers Local 49 voted June 18 to ratify a new master agreement with 13 union-signatory roofing contractors in the Portland metro area. The agreement will raise compensation $10.28 an hour over the contract’s four-year term. It’s expected that $3 of that increase will go toward maintaining health coverage.
